A New Way to "Look" at Parenthood,
By A Customer
This review is from: We Are Not Alone - A Baby Blues Book (Little Books (Andrews & McMeel)) (Hardcover)
Rick Kirkman and Jerry Scott are genuises. Their writing is some of the funniest anywhere, and their drawings are amazing too. We have all seen Baby Blues from the eyes of the entire family, but this new book shows us the MacPherson home from the eyes of Darryl and Wanda, an exciting new twist. This book is especially good because it is something that the parents can relate to as well, widening the audience and increasing the amount of people who will open to the comics and read Baby Blues every day. Baby Blues is an extremely great comic strip, and thi new book, "We are not Alone", is a great addition.
